In Do Hard Things, the Harris brothers attempt to "explode the myth of adolescence," and show that prior to the 20th century, a person was either an adult or a child. [5] The book challenges teenagers to go beyond their comfort zone, [6] and, in essence, "do hard things." The foreword was contributed by Chuck Norris.
Glennon Doyle (born March 20, 1976) is an American author and queer activist known for her books Untamed, Love Warrior, and Carry On, Warrior. [1] [2] Doyle is also the creator of the online community Momastery, [3] and is the founder and president of Together Rising, [4] an all-women-led nonprofit organization supporting women, families, and children in crisis.

Two Soft Things, Two Hard Things is a Canadian documentary film, written, produced and directed by Mark Kenneth Woods and Michael Yerxa, [1] which debuted at the Inside Out Film and Video Festival on June 3, 2016. [2] The film was produced by MKW Productions and was shot in Nunavut. [3]
